Celebrate your love story in timeless style with the Today, Tomorrow, Forever Wedding Collection from White City Florist in White City. Designed for modern couples who want every floral detail to feel romantic, refined and cohesive, this premium wedding flower package is available in three flexible sizes to suit intimate gatherings or grand celebrations. Each collection includes a beautifully hand-tied bridal bouquet, coordinating bridesmaid bouquets, elegant corsages, and groom boutonnières, all crafted by our expert florists using fresh, high-quality blooms. Choose the Intimate Package for 50-75 guests, the Original Package for 75-100 guests, or the Ultimate Package for 100+ guests and enjoy a seamless, stress-free floral experience from consultation to the big day.
